What is the IUIH Oral Health Services?
The IUIH Oral Health Services is a non-profit grant offered by Queensland Health in Australia. Procurement for the provision of dental services for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ander clients in South East Queensland under the IUIH Oral Health service.
Who is eligible for the IUIH Oral Health Services?
Frontline service procurement Related to oral health and dental service delivery Services targeted to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ander clients in South East Queensland Detailed applicant eligibility not stated in the supplied content
What activities are funded?
Delivery of oral health and dental services to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ander clients in South East Queensland.
